South Africa will face host nation, Morocco, in the quarterfinals of the 2025 U-17 Africa Cup of Nations tournament, after finishing as runners-up in Group B of the continental championship’s first round.
Amajimbos began with a bang by coming back from a two goal deficit to beat Egypt 4-3 in their opening match, with Kaizer Chiefs starlet, Neo Bohloko. netting twice from the penalty spot. They followed up with 0-0 draw against Cameroon and then a 2-0 loss to group winners, Burkina Faso. However, Egypt’s win over Cameroon in their final fixture ensured South Africa a second-placed finish and a berth in the quarterfinals.
Vela Khumalo’s side will have to be at their best to overcome Morocco in their own back yard when the teams meet on Thursday, 10 April at the El Baschir stadium in Mohammedia.
